A Phase I Study of [68Ga]Ga-DWJ155 in Patients With Breast and Lung Cancers
Recruiting now · Phase 1
Conditions studied: Breast Neoplasms, Carcinoma, Non-Small-Cell Lung
In brief
This is a phase I, open label first in human study to evaluate the imaging performance, safety, biodistribution and pharmacokinetics of \[68Ga\]Ga-DWJ155 in patients ≥ 18 years of age with hormone receptor positive/HER2 negative (HR+/HER2-) and HER2 positive (HER2+) advanced breast cancer (aBC) and advanced Non-Small Cell Lung Cancer (aNSCLC) adenocarcinoma.

Who can join
Age: 18 and older, up to 100. Sex: any. Healthy volunteers: not accepted.
You may qualify if…
- Age ≥ 18 years old
- Patients with histologically or cytologically confirmed and documented HR+/HER2- advanced breast cancer (aBC), advanced defined as locoregionally advanced unresectable or metastatic, either untreated or currently receiving first line of systemic therapy OR patients with histologically or cytologically confirmed and documented HER2+ aBC, advanced defined as locoregionally advanced unresectable or metastatic, either untreated or relapsed/refractory (r/r) after one or more lines of treatment OR patients with histologically or cytologically confirmed and documented advanced NSCLC (aNSCLC) adenocarcinoma, advanced defined as locoregionally unresectable or metastatic, either untreated or currently receiving first line of systemic therapy.
- Presence of measurable disease (at least one target lesion) according to RECIST v1.1 assessed by conventional CT scan.
You may not qualify if…
- Patients having out of range laboratory values for kidney function and blood markers as defined in the study protocol
- Patients with inadequate hepatic function
- Unmanageable urinary tract obstruction or urinary incontinence
- Other protocol-defined inclusion/exclusion criteria may apply.
